WebJul 6, 2024 · Belle Meade is one of the oldest of the Western thoroughbred nurseries. It was settled by Mr. John Harding, the father of General W.G. Harding, in 1804. The mighty Priam, winner of the English Derby in 1840, here held court, also Eagle and Bluster, imported horses, were in their day at the head of Belle Meade Stud. These require a special scanner to locate and read. A veterinarian or animal shelter often can assist with this. With the microchip information, you might be able to find the horse's previous owner or breeder.
